To be a journeyman electrical contractor implies to be on the 2nd level of seniority in a three-phase electric career. The phases are as follows: apprentice, journeyman, and master electrical expert. While some journeymen function for electrical business, others are self-employed. Journeymen may deal with household, industrial, or commercial buildings, each of which comes with its very own set of obligations.


Regardless, all electricians are anticipated to accomplish the very best methods for electrical security and comply with the National Electric Code (NEC). A lot of a journeyman's work involves mounting, attaching, checking, repairing, and preserving electric systems and parts, including circuitry, outlets, home appliances, electric buttons, breaker, security systems, and lights.


All journeyman and master electrical contractors must be certified to legally work. Some go to technical school, while others are trained with an apprenticeship. Apprenticeships typically last 3 to five years and are supplied by numerous organizations, local unions, or certified electrical contractors eager to advisor and have someone work under them. Apprentices should track their hours and total 4,000 to 8,000 hours on the job (relying on the program) prior to certifying to take a journeyman's exam.
